Lal Babu Raut: Government's Actions Criticized, New Front Formed for Political Reform

Summary

Lal Babu Raut has sharply criticized the federal government, accusing it of undermining federalism, hurting farmers and youth, and worsening inflation, unemployment, and border restrictions. He says the new progressive front formed by Madhesi parties is meant to reform politics and prepare for future electoral alliances.

Key Points
  • Lal Babu Raut says the new progressive front was formed to defend achievements like federalism, republic, proportional inclusion, and secularism.
  • He accuses the federal government of mismanagement, rising fees, border restrictions, and pressure on farmers, students, traders, and youth.
  • Raut argues that provincial and local politics are being destabilized by power games played by central parties.
  • He says JSP Nepal and other Madhesi forces may also consider future electoral alliances and potential participation in government.
